The Wright brothers, Orville (August 19, 1871 – January 30, 1948) and Wilbur (April 16, 1867 – May 30, 1912), were two brothers, inventors, and pioneers in the aviation field. They are credited with inventing and building the first successful airplane and making the first successful flight, on December 17, 1903.
